xiphoid process; ensiform cartilage
Anatomical term for the small cartilaginous extension at the lower end of the sternum.
剣状突起は胸骨の下端にある小さな突起です。
The xiphoid process is a small projection at the lower end of the sternum.
The term is composed of 剣状 (sword-shaped) and 突起 (projection), describing its shape. The exact historical derivation is uncertain; the spelling is conventionally associated with this anatomical structure.
